兰州交通大学数据库期末复习资料

1.数据库:是描述事物的符号记录,是信息的载体,是信息的具体表现形式。2.数据库技术的三个发展阶段:(1)人工管理阶段:硬件,外存只有磁带、卡片、纸带,没有磁盘等直接存取的存储设备;软件,没有操作系统

1 .数据库: 是描述事物的符号 以是任何由系统提供的或用户 据库应用系统、数据库管理员 次。 DU 集合,是属性组中属性所 记录,是信息的载体,是信息 22 .数据定义语言 DDL ()用 定义的数据类型。但是,变量 和用户构成。 dom 来自的域,是属性向域的 的具体表现形式。 于执行数据库任务,对数据库 textntexrimage 不能是或数 11 .联系的类型 : 映像集合 以及数据库中的各种对象进行 据类型 6 .数据库 DataBase,DB ()就 1:1 一对一联系()。一对多联 2 .数据库技术的三个发展阶 段: CREATE(DROP) 创建()、删除、 是存放数据库的仓库,是将数 1M 系(:)。多对多联系 15 .关系的完整性 :实体完整 1 () 人工管理阶段:硬件,外 (ALTER) 修改等操作。 27 .局部变量的赋值方法: 据按一定的数据模型组织、描 M:N ()。 性、参照完整性、用户自定义 存只有磁带、卡片、纸带,没 DECLARE 使用命令声明并 述和存储,能够自动进行查询 完整性。 有磁盘等直接存取的存储设备; 23 .数据库操纵语言 DML () 创建变量之后,系统会将其初 和修改的数据集合。 12 .数据模型 :由数据结构(对 软件,没有操作系统,没有管 用于操纵数据库中各种对象, NULL 始值设为,如果想要设 计算机的数据组织方式和数据 16 .关系运算 :关系代数的运 理数据的软件,数据处理的方 inster.. 检索和修改数据。增删 SET 定变量的值,必须使用命 7 .数据库管理系统 DataBase ( 直接联系进行框架性描述的集 算对象是关系,运算结果也是 式是批处理。 deleteupdateselect. 修查 SELECT 令或者命令 ManagementSystem,DBMS )是 合,是对数据库静态特征的描 关系。 2 () 文件系统阶段:硬件,磁 SET{@local_variable= 数据库系统的核心,是为数据 述)、数据操作(指数据库中 盘为主要外存储器;软件,高 24 .数据控制语言 DCL ()用 expression}SELECT 或者 库建立、使用和维护而配置的 各记录允许执行的操作的集合, 17 .关系代数中的操作也分为 级语言和操作系统。 于安全管理,确定哪些用户可 {@local_variable= 软件。 包括操作方法及有关的操作规 1 两类() :传统的集合操作, 3 () 数据库系统阶段:统一管 以查看或修改数据库中的数据。 expression}[…n] 、 则等,如插入、修改、检索、 2 () 并、差、交、笛卡尔积。 理和共享数据的数据库管理系 GRANT. 授予权限()收回权 @local_variable 其中:参数是 8 .数据库管理系统的功能 :数 更新等)、数据的完整性约束 专门的关系操作(关系特有的 DBMS 统()。 REVOKE 限()收回权限, 给其赋值并声明的变量, 据定义和操纵功能。数据库运 (数据的约束条件是关于数据 运算),投影(对关系进行垂 并禁止从其他角色继承许可权 expressionSQL 是有效的 行控制功能。数据库的组织、 状态和状态变化的一组完整性 直分割)、选择(水平分割)、连 3 .数据库系统的特点 : DENY 限() Server 表达式。 存储和管理。建立和维护数据 约束规则的集合,以保证数据 接(关系的结合)、除法(笛 数据结构化。较高的数据共享 库。数据通信接口。 的正确性、有效性和一致性) 卡尔积的逆运算)等。 性。较高的数据独立性。数据 25Select12 .列,列 28SQLServer2005 .数据库 三部分组成。 DBMS 由统一管理和控制。 From12 表,表 的文件的三种类型 ① 。主数据 9 .数据库的三级模式结构 :外 A .数据模型:层次模型。网 18 .数据库设计过程的步骤 : Where 条件 .mdf② 文件扩展名辅助数据 模式、模式和内模式。 状模型。关系模型。 需求分析、概念结构设计、逻 4 .数据库概念 :数据库指长期 Groupby .ndf③ 文件推荐扩展名事务 辑结构设计、数据库物理设计、 存储在计算机系统内有组织的、 日志文件每个数据库必须至 10 .数据库的两级映像 :外模 13 .关系数据模型 :用二维表 数据库实施、运行和维护等内 可共享的数据集合,即在计算 26 .局部变量定义一般格式: 少有一个日志文件扩展名 / 式模式映像(逻辑独立性)。 格结构表示实体以及实体之间 容。 机系统中按一定的数据模型组 DECLAER{@local_variable .ldf / 模式内模式映像(物理独立 的联系的数据模型。 20SQLServer2005 .的版本 织、存储和使用的相关联的数 data_type}[…n] 性)。 企业版。标准版。工作组版。 据集合。 ①@local_variable: 用于指定变 29 .逻辑数据库 : 14 .关系模式 :关系的描述称 精简版。开发人员版。 @ 量的名称,变量名必须以开 ①master 数据库主数据库 10 .概念模型及作用 :是现实 为关系模式。一个关系模式应 5 .数据库系统的概念:计 指在 SQL 头,并且变量名必须符合 ②model 数据库提供模板 世界的抽象反映,它表示实体 当是一个五元组。关系模式可 21SQL() .结构化查询语言语 算机系统中引入数据库后的系 Server 的命名规则。 ③msdb 数据库调度警报作 类型及实体间的联系,是独立 以形式化的表示为, 言 是集数据定义、数据查询、 统,一般由数据库、数据库管 ②data_type: 用于设置变量的 业以及记录操作 于计算机系统的模型,是现实 R(U,D,dom,F).R 其中,是关系 数据操纵和数据控制功能于一 理系统、数据库开发工具、数 data_type 数据类型及大小,可 ④tempdb 数据库保存临时表 世界到机器世界的一个中间层 U 名,是组成该关系的属性名 体的语言

腾讯文库兰州交通大学数据库期末复习资料